Huffaker’s Willow Dog Park in Somerset, Kentucky, is a popular pet-friendly destination offering a welcoming space for families and their four-legged friends. This dog park is wheelchair accessible, ensuring everyone can enjoy the amenities. Not only is there a secure, fenced dog park area where dogs can run freely off-leash, but visitors also enjoy the nearby playground, splash pad, and a large grassy field ideal for games and relaxation. The park is noted for its clean environment and features a combination of activities, making it a top choice for dog owners and families alike in Somerset.
Dog owners appreciate the included obstacle course and agility equipment, as well as the two separate sections for dogs of different sizes, which adds to the safety and enjoyment for all pets. The park is shaded and provides a paved walking track perfect for pet-friendly strolls or young riders on bikes and scooters. With ample seating and shaded areas, parents and pet owners can relax comfortably while keeping an eye on their children or furry companions. Huffaker’s Willow Dog Park stands out as a well-maintained, multi-use community hub with activities for everyone.
